雷帕霉素诱导Balb/c小鼠CD4~+ CD25~+ foxp3~+调节性T细胞增殖

摘    要:目的探讨雷帕霉素对Balb/c小鼠CD4+ CD25+ foxp3+调节性T细胞的作用。方法取8wk龄的SPF级Balb/c小鼠30只,随机分为两组,实验组每只灌胃雷帕霉素0.4mg.d-1,对照组灌胃每天予等体积无菌水,共3wk。无菌条件下肝素抗凝心脏采血,分离脾脏,制备单细胞悬液。采用流式细胞仪检测小鼠外周血和脾细胞CD4+CD25+T细胞,实时定量PCR检测小鼠脾细胞foxp3 mRNA的表达。结果实验组小鼠外周血和脾细胞中CD4+CD25+T细胞的比例分别为(9.95±4.65)%和(24.13±10.06)%,对照组小鼠外周血和脾细胞中CD4+CD25+T细胞的比例分别为(5.01±1.49)%和(8.48±3.19)%,差异均有显著性(P<0.01)。实验组小鼠脾细胞foxp3 mRNA的表达水平明显高于对照组,是对照组的6.029倍,差异有显著性(P<0.01)。结论雷帕霉素能够明显诱导Balb/c小鼠体内CD4+CD25+T细胞的增殖,并能提高foxp3+ mRNA的表达。

Rapamycin induces Balb/c murine CD4+CD25+foxp3+T cells proliferations

Abstract:Aim To investigate rapamycin(RAPA)induce Balb/c murine CD4+CD25+ foxp3+T cells proliferations.Methods Balb/c mice aging 8~10 weeks were used. RAPA was given to Balb/c murine 0.4 mg/day intragastric administration. The mice were given with sterile water as the control group, all mice were kept under specific pathogen-free conditions. drinking water and food were steriled. After three weeks, peripheral blood was collected and spleen cells were prepared, CD4+CD25+T cells were detected with FCM(CD4-pcy5, CD25-FITC), the relative levels of foxp3 mRNA were determined by Real-time quantitative RT-PCR in total splenocytes.Results The CD4+CD25+T cell of peripheral blood of experimental group and control group was (9.95±4.65)% and (5.01±1.49)%, respectively (P<0.01),and CD4+CD25+T cell of experimental mice splenocytes was (24.13±10.06)%,while control group was (8.48±3.19)% (P<0.01).Real-time quantitative RT-PCR showed that the levels of foxp3 mRNA of experimental mice splenocytes was 6.029 folds than that of control group(P<0.01).Conclusion RAPA can induce Balb/c murine CD4+CD25+T cells proliferation and enhanced foxp3+ mRNA in vivo,which suggested that RAPA could increase CD4+CD25+foxp3+T cells on the autoimmune disease and graft versus host disease treatment.
